I agree the recipe was very poorly written. But since I am a food TV junkie I used all the ingredients called for, just didn't really follow the directions.
1 saute shrimp & oil - put in bowl
2 saute asparagus & oil - put in bowl w/shrimp
3 Saute onion (I can't cook w/o onion & garlic until clear
4 Add garlic - 30 sec
5 Deglaze with wine - reduce by 1/2
6 Add lemon juice - reduce by 1/2
7 Add tomatoes, shrimp & asparagus, and parsley - let combine for about 2 min
I also didn't use linquine. It was 90 deg here yesterday. So used Couscous - less heat in the house.
It was WONDERFUL! Even my very PICKY 2 year old loved it.
